What does an Adobe Acrobat Remote do?

An Adobe Acrobat Remote job typically involves working from a remote location to manage, edit, create, or review PDF documents using Adobe Acrobat software. Responsibilities can include converting files to PDF, adding or removing text or images, securing documents with passwords, and collaborating with team members on document workflows. These roles may also require troubleshooting PDF-related issues and ensuring documents are accessible and compliant with standards. Knowledge of Adobe Acrobat's advanced features and strong attention to detail are important for this role.

Responsibilities:
  • Maintain accurate docketing of all case deadlines, filings, and court dates.
  • Draft and prepare pleadings, motions, financial disclosures, discovery responses, subpoenas, and witness disclosures.
  • File documents electronically using the Colorado Courts E-Filing system (CCEF).
  • Ensure case files are organized and compliant with court and firm procedures.
  • Coordinate and schedule mediations, hearings, and client meetings.
  • Communicate effectively and professionally with attorneys, clients, court staff, and opposing counsel.
  • Assist with trial preparation, including creating and organizing exhibits and trial notebooks.
  • Utilize Adobe Acrobat for document preparation, including creating and editing PDFs.

Qualifications:
  • Minimum 2 years of family law paralegal experience preferred, including familiarity with Colorado family law rules and procedures.
  • Strong organizational and docketing skills with exceptional attention to detail.
  • A positive and professional attitude.
  • Proficiency in Adobe Acrobat for document management.
  • Skilled in using CCEF, Microsoft Office Suite, and case management software; experience with Clio is a plus.
  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team in a remote setting.
  • Flexibility to work in the office as needed.
